LE:SURE ELECTRIC BIKE MANUAL

Riding Tips

1. Before riding, check to make sure the battery is fully charged, that the air pressure in 

the tyres is normal, and make sure the front and back brakes are working properly. 
Check the tightness of the front and back wheel, handlebar and that the seat is 
fastened tightly enough.

2. When climbing steep hills a certain amount of pedalling is advisable so as not to drain 

the battery power  too quickly.

3. It’s a good idea to remove the battery key when leaving the bike unattended.

4. We recommend the wearing of safety helmets at all times while riding this bike.

5. Obey all traffic laws relevant to the operation of bicycles and electric bicycles.

6. Only one person at a time is permitted to ride this bike.

7. This bike is for use on public roads and pavements only – try to avoid ‘Off Roading’ 

and rough terrain.

8. Please avoid deep puddles.

9. KEEP both hands on the handlebars at all times.

10. DO NOT hang objects on or under the handlebars

11. DO NOT brake suddenly in the rain or on slippery wet surfaces.

12. USE extreme caution when near other vehicles. Assume they do not see you, and be 

careful at junctions  and when starting from a stopped position.

13. Wear bright clothing to help make you visible to other motor vehicles.

14. Do not wear loose clothing that can become caught on the bicycle.
